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ive quickly to assess the damage and contain the affected area to prevent further water intrusion.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ect moisture levels and identify areas of concern.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ring a successful restoration process.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Drying
Next, our technicians will extract any standing water from the affected area using industrial-grade pumps and vacuums. We’ll then use specialized drying equipment to evaporate any remaining moisture. This step is critical in preventing mold and mildew growth.
Step 3: Cleaning and Disinfecting
Once the area is dry, our team will thoroughly clean and disinfect the affected area to prevent any remaining bacteria or mold from growing. We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ure a safe and healthy environment.
Step 4: Inspection and Restoration
Finally, our technicians will inspect the affected area to ensure that all damage has been repaired and your hardwood floors are back to their original beauty. We’ll make any necessary repairs to ensure a lasting solution.

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ak under 1 square foot | Yes | No | DIY is fine for small leaks, but be sure to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age. |
| Large flood with standing water | No | Yes | A large flood needs professional equipment and expertise to dry and restore your floors safely and effectively. |
| Water damage on a small section of floor | Maybe | Yes | While DIY might be an option for small water damage, it’s often safer and more efficient to call a professional to ensure a thorough and lasting solution. |
| Water damage on a large section of floor | No | Yes | A large section of water damage needs professional equipment and expertise to dry and restore your floors safely and effectively. |
| Water damage with visible mold or mildew | No | Yes | Visible mold or mildew needs professional attention to ensure a safe and healthy environment. |
| Water damage with unknown source | No | Yes | An unknown source of water damage needs professional expertise to identify and address the issue safely and effectively. |

Q: How long does it take to restore hardwood floors after water damage?
A: The time it takes to restore hardwood floors after water damage varies dep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Typically, it takes 3-5 days to dry and restore hardwood floors. Our team will work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your home back to normal as soon as possible.
Q: Is it safe to walk on hardwood floors after water damage?
A: No, it’s not safe to walk on hardwood floors after water damage until they’ve been properly dried and restored. Walking on wet floors can cause further damage and create health risks. Our team will ensure that your floors are safe and healthy before allowing you to walk on them.
Q: Can I use a wet/dry vacuum to dry my hardwood floors?
A: No, it’s not recommended to use a wet/dry vacuum to dry hardwood floors. This can cause further damage and create uneven drying patterns. Our team uses specialized equipment to dry and restore hardwood floors safely and effectively.
